Dramatic Rate Acceleration by a Diphenyl-2-pyridylphosphine Ligand in the Hydration of Nitriles Catalyzed by Ru(acac) 2 Complexes

Resumo

New ruthenium(II) complexes having acac (=acetylacetonato) and diphenyl-2-pyridylphosphine as ligands proved to be excellent catalysts for hydration of nitriles to amides under neutral conditions. Among the ruthenium complexes examined, cis-Ru(acac)2(PPh2py)2 exhibited the highest activity, with a turnover frequency of up to 20 900 (mol of amide)/((mol of catalyst) h).
